Robert (Rob) Ivan Phillips, age 64, of Washington, PA passed away peacefully on Sunday,December 21, 2025. Rob was born on March 6, 1961 in Pittsburgh, PA to the late Robert Phillip and Patricia Ullom.
Rob was a Navy Veteran, last serving on the USS Elmer Montgomery and being honorably discharged in 1981. He had many jobs throughout the years, his most recent was a Teamster driver for the Shell Eathan Cracker Plant in Beaver, PA. Outside of work, Rob enjoyed cruising on his Harley, traveling, and spending time with family and friends. He was very intelligent and quick witted – laughs were always expected when in his company.
He was a dog lover and the pups he left behind will miss his comforting presence. He was active in the Arms Club of Washington, VFW Post 927, American Legion Post 175, and the Elks of Washington.
In addition to his parents, Rob was preceded in death by his grandparents that held a significant role in raising him: Ivan Leslie Ullom and Marian Aliene Ullom, his brothers:Delbert (Eddie) Sinclair and Richard Sinclair, his aunt, who he was raised with as a sister: Bonnie DeBerry (Kirk), his granddaughter: Brianna Phillips-Sommer, and his nephew: Michael Newberry Rob is survived by his significant-other, Diana Cummins of Washington, PA, daughters:Elizabeth Porter (David Lahr) and Leslie Aviles (Dan Wolfram) of Minnesota, his bonus daughter: Brandi White (Justin) of Pennsylvania, his only cherished sister: Dianna Newberry (David) of Georgia, his uncle that he was raised with as a brother, Ivan Ullom(Tonie) of Pennsylvania, grandchildren and bonus grandchildren: Elaesah, Mario, Loni,Hannah, Molly, Hayden, Teagan, and many other loved ones and friends.
All arrangements are private and entrusted to the care of William G. Neal Funeral Home, Ltd., 925 Allison Ave. Washington PA
